Transaction 4407e94986ee8c49ece05adea681a6e9e2fdc9c8a914f21f26023fccbe961193
2 Input
2 Outputs
- 4407e94986ee8c49ece05adea681a6e9e2fdc9c8a914f21f26023fccbe961193:0
- 4407e94986ee8c49ece05adea681a6e9e2fdc9c8a914f21f26023fccbe961193:1
value 11957562
address 13odmyYhNS6gLWNwhssyoZPU5aRVchibsu
value 181555
address 1CZuWCy7u6mjY4egsokV6QkYY49Wz9adwZ